数学建模社区-数学中国
标题:
数学建模
[打印本页]
作者:
__淡然、、
时间:
2012-7-10 21:47
标题:
数学建模
function [d,r]=floyd(a)
0 C8 ~. q" B. h. Q/ ^* v
%floyd.m
0 X! G* m$ d- U: Y1 n
%采用floyd算法计算图a中每对顶点最短路
, i5 x. a( M$ y8 ^) o/ d% d
%d是矩离矩阵
7 y9 A" e: x6 z% g% y* y! ~
%r是路由矩阵
9 I! o! J7 D/ J7 U
n=size(a,1);
3 U) I1 M+ a7 X% p% E
d=a;
7 l& |0 | _9 L
for i=1:n
/ S4 w2 n+ ~; ?- r2 Y5 l* Z' Z' f
for j=1:n
( ] O6 j' W) N$ E% K% \
r(i,j)=j;
% l! P: J" E5 M+ m( N0 D& K0 n, t
end
- e4 G) ^0 i* H4 y6 x' d
end
1 E* h0 j5 e" |
r
2 J6 v1 G0 ]- Z3 }
for k=1:n
) o1 J& B; h7 v9 J! q
for i=1:n
5 l) T e3 {: A6 U7 D
for j=1:n
( G/ q6 O8 ?& ]) `7 c6 }
if d(i,j)>d(i,k)+d(k,j)
$ q0 p5 S9 I7 Z% t3 `
d(i,j)=d(i,k)+d(k,j);
: x) R7 R; G, y
r(i,j)=r(i,k)
! E4 t. O2 @, m" g' h
end
4 d" a& V/ F# t
end
( U1 y" n+ f- b
end
( v. n" j# z A6 D1 Z
k
6 Y G5 O. m* `+ r+ ?
d
# c- t- a* t/ w l+ [
r
% ~8 b# _# C6 Q) M( E; [
end
4 W3 `" U! M* ?5 p* X
里面a指的是什么
作者:
秋leaves
时间:
2012-7-11 08:47
楼主,a是指你所作出的图啊
欢迎光临 数学建模社区-数学中国 (http://www.madio.net/)
Powered by Discuz! X2.5